Water flows in a circular pipe. At one section the diameter is 0.3 m, the static pressure is 260 kPa (gage), the velocity is 3 m/s, and the elevation is 10 m above the ground level. At a section downstream at ground level, the pipe diameter is 0.15 m. Find the gage pressure at the downstream section if frictional effects may be neglected.
